Context
Released on July 8, 1989, 'Believe' was The Jets' third studio album, following their successful self-titled debut in 1985 and the more mature sound of 'Magic' in 1987. At this point in their career, the band was riding the wave of their earlier hits while continuing to explore a mix of pop and R&B influences.
